Here’s a refined yet simple Grilled Salmon on Cauliflower Cream (Purée) recipe. It’s light, elegant, and full of flavor — great for a dinner party or a cozy weeknight meal.

Ingredients - serves 2-3


2–3 salmon fillets (about 150–180 g / 5–6 oz each, skin on)

1 tbsp olive oil

Salt and freshly ground pepper

1 tsp lemon juice

½ head of cauliflower (about 400–500 g / 1 lb), cut into florets

1 small onion, finely chopped

1–2 tbsp butter or olive oil

100 ml (about ⅓ cup) vegetable broth

100 ml (about ⅓ cup) heavy cream or milk (for a lighter version)

Salt, pepper, and a pinch of nutmeg




Method


In a saucepan, heat butter or olive oil and sauté the onion until translucent.

Add cauliflower florets and cook for 2–3 minutes.

Pour in the vegetable broth, cover, and let simmer for about 10–12 minutes until the cauliflower is very tender.

Add cream or milk, then blend everything until smooth and creamy.

Season with salt, pepper, and a little nutmeg. Keep warm.



Brush the salmon with olive oil and season with salt and pepper.

Grill (or pan-sear) skin-side down for 4–5 minutes, until the skin is crispy.

Flip and cook for another 2–3 minutes, until just cooked through but still moist inside.

Drizzle with lemon juice.

Spread a generous spoonful of cauliflower cream on each plate.

Place the grilled salmon on top.
